The inverter system also has some charging system that charges the battery during utility power. During utility power, the battery of the inverter is charged and at the same time power is supplied to the loads in the house. When utility power fails, the battery system begins to supply power via the inverter to the loads in the home as shown below:

The power of the battery is 360W (12V x 30A= 360W). The power output of the inverter is 360W (120V x 3A= 360W). You can see that the transformer within a power inverter conserves power. Power isn't created but simply transformed (from a lower voltage higher current DC source to a higher voltage lower current AC source).

For example, an inverter with a rated output power of 5,000 W and a peak efficiency of 95% requires an input power of 5,263 W to operate at full power. Hybrid solar inverters represent a true ''battery ready'' inverter setup, as described in our article on the truth about battery ready systems. But you don''t have to have a hybrid inverter for a battery system. Using a method called "AC coupling", you can retrofit batteries to any existing solar system regardless of what inverter you have.
